‘The Batman’, ‘Elvis’ major makeup and hairstyling nominations

“The Batman” and “Elvis” lead all films in nominations for the 2023 Make-Up Artists and Hairstylists Guild Awards, Julie Sokash, president of the MUAHS (IATSE Local 706), announced Wednesday.

Those two films received three nominations in five feature-film categories, while “Everything Everywhere at Once,” “The Menu,” “Amsterdam,” “Babylon,” “Blonde” and “Black Panther: Wakanda Forever” each received one. Received two.

Film nominees included seven films on the 10-film Oscar shortlist in the Best Makeup and Hairstyling category: “Amsterdam,” “Babylon,” “The Batman,” “Black Panther,” “Blonde,” “Elvis” and “The Whale.” An additional three films – “All Quiet on the Western Front,” “Crimes of the Future” and “Emancipation” – were shortlisted by the Academy but not nominated by the Guild.

Last year, all five Oscar nominees previously received multiple nominations from MUAHS. (Guild hyphenates accomplish and separates hair styling In two words, whereas the Oscars consider them both to be one word.)

In the television categories, the limited series “Pam & Tommy” received three nominations, while “Abbott Elementary,” “Emily in Paris,” “Bridgerton” and “Stranger Things” received two nominations each.

The Guild also announced nominations in the daytime television, children’s television, commercials and music videos, and theatrical production categories.

Winners will be announced at the 2023 MUHS Guild Awards, which will take place on February 11 at the Beverly Hilton. Actress and comedian Melissa Peterman will host.
